@charset "utf-8";
/* CSS Document */

.research-b{background-image:url(../img/int-banner4.jpg); background-repeat:no-repeat; background-position:50% 50%; background-size:cover; position:relative;}


.research-con{ padding:70px 0;}

.research-con .blue-tl{ text-align:center; margin-bottom:70px;}
.research-con .blue-tl h2{ font-size:32px; font-weight:normal; color:#0d2f89;}

.research-left{ width:580px; float:left;}
.research-left .blue-tl{ text-align:left;}
.research-col{ line-height:24px; font-size:14px;}
.research-col h3{ font-size:20px; font-weight:normal; margin-bottom:20px;}
.research-right{ width:580px; float:right;}
.research-right img{ width:100%; !important(display:block);}

.research-honer{ position:relative;}
.research-honer-bg{ background:#0d2f89; width:100%; height:330px; position:absolute; left:0; top:0;}
.recer-tl{ padding:70px 0 50px; text-align:center; color:#fff;}
.recer-tl h2{ font-size:32px; font-weight:normal; margin-bottom:10px;}
.recer-tl p{ font-size:30px;}
.re-honer-pic ul li{ width:380px; float:left; margin-right:20px;}
.re-honer-pic ul li:last-child{ margin-right:0;}
.re-honer-pic ul li img{ display:block; width:100%;}


.research-team ul li{ width:380px; float:left; margin-right:20px;}
.research-team ul li:last-child{ margin-right:0;}
.research-team ul li img{ display:block; width:100%;}



@media (max-width:1200px){  
   .research-left{width:100%; float:none;}
   .research-right{width:100%; float:none;}
   .re-honer-pic ul li,.research-team ul li{ width:32%; margin-right:2%;}
	}


@media (max-width:750px){
	.research-con .blue-tl h2{ font-size:22px;}
	.recer-tl h2{ font-size:22px;}
	.recer-tl p{ font-size:16px;}
   .re-honer-pic ul li, .research-team ul li{ width:100%; margin-right:0; margin-bottom:2%;}
	}